The False Economy of Floor Stacking
The traditional approach to storing sheet metal creates a deceptive cost structure. While it appears free at implementation, floor stacking accrues daily expenses through material degradation and workplace hazards. These hidden costs manifest in two primary forms:
Material Loss Through Rummaging
When operators need to access a sheet from the middle or bottom of a floor-stacked pile, they must perform a labor-intensive “rummaging” process. This involves:
- Lifting multiple sheets with forklifts or cranes
- Shifting them to temporary locations
- Re-stacking them after target sheet retrieval Each handling operation introduces opportunities for surface damage. For premium materials like stainless steel or aluminum, even minor scratches can significantly reduce material value. The cumulative effect of these micro-damages erodes profit margins over time.
Elevated Workplace Danger
The rummaging process transforms sheet storage into one of the most hazardous activities in fabrication facilities. Key risk factors include:
- Unstable loads during partial extraction
- Close proximity of multiple workers to suspended materials
- Potential for miscommunication between operators
- Unpredictable load shifting during extraction These conditions create an environment where routine operations carry life-altering injury risks, exposing businesses to significant liability concerns.
